What is preschool prep

Preschool preparation encompasses activities and programs designed to help young children develop the necessary skills and knowledge to succeed in preschool and beyond. By providing a solid foundation in essential areas such as language, literacy, numeracy, and social-emotional development, preschool preparation programs lay the groundwork for future academic and life success.

Benefits of Preschool Preparation

Preschool preparation offers numerous benefits for children, including:

– Enhanced Cognitive Development: Preschool preparation activities stimulate cognitive growth, improving children’s problem-solving, critical thinking, and language comprehension abilities.

– Improved Literacy Skills: Exposure to books, songs, and storytelling during preschool preparation fosters a love of reading and develops early literacy skills, such as letter recognition, phonics, and vocabulary.

– Stronger Numeracy Foundation: Preschool preparation programs introduce basic mathematical concepts, such as counting, number recognition, and shape recognition, providing a foundation for future math success.

– Enhanced Social-Emotional Development: Preschool preparation activities encourage children to interact with peers, develop self-regulation skills, and build empathy, fostering social and emotional growth.

Essential Skills for Preschool Success

Preschool is an important milestone in a child’s development, providing them with a foundation for future academic and social success. To ensure a smooth transition into preschool, it is crucial to foster essential skills in cognitive, social, emotional, and physical domains.

This table Artikels key skills for preschool readiness and strategies to develop them:

Skill AreaEssential SkillsStrategies for Development
Cognitive– Problem-solving
– Memory
– Language development
– Play games that involve problem-solving, such as puzzles or building blocks.
– Read stories and ask questions about the characters and plot.
– Encourage conversations and use rich language in everyday interactions.
Social– Cooperation
– Communication
– Empathy
– Engage in group play activities, such as pretend play or board games.
– Encourage children to express their thoughts and feelings.
– Model empathy and kindness in interactions with others.
Emotional– Self-regulation
– Confidence
– Resilience
– Provide opportunities for children to practice self-control, such as waiting for turns or managing their emotions.
– Praise children for their efforts and accomplishments.
– Encourage them to face challenges and learn from mistakes.
Physical– Gross motor skills
– Fine motor skills
– Hand-eye coordination
– Engage in physical activities such as running, jumping, and playing with balls.
– Provide opportunities for drawing, cutting, and building with blocks.
– Encourage children to participate in activities that involve hand-eye coordination, such as playing catch or throwing bean bags.

Challenges of Transitioning

  • Separation anxiety: Young children may experience distress when separated from their primary caregivers for an extended period.
  • Adjustment to a new routine: Preschool introduces a structured schedule that may differ from a child’s home routine, requiring them to adapt to new expectations.
  • Social interactions: Preschool provides opportunities for children to interact with peers, which can be both stimulating and overwhelming for some.
  • Sensory overload: The preschool environment can be filled with noise, bright lights, and various textures, which may overstimulate some children.

Benefits of Transitioning

  • Social development: Preschool provides a safe and supervised environment for children to develop social skills, such as sharing, cooperation, and empathy.
  • Cognitive development: Preschool activities promote cognitive development through play, exploration, and problem-solving.
  • Emotional development: Preschool helps children develop self-regulation skills, learn to express their emotions appropriately, and build resilience.
  • School readiness: Preschool prepares children for future academic success by introducing them to basic concepts, such as numbers, letters, and shapes.

Preparing Your Child for Preschool

  • Practice separation: Gradually increase the time your child spends away from you in the weeks leading up to preschool.
  • Establish a routine: Implement a consistent daily routine at home that includes time for play, meals, and sleep.
  • Visit the preschool: Take your child to visit the preschool before their first day to familiarize them with the environment and staff.
  • Talk to your child: Explain to your child what preschool is like and why it’s important. Answer their questions and address any concerns they may have.

Building a Positive Relationship with the Preschool Teacher

  • Communicate openly: Share information about your child’s strengths, challenges, and daily routine with the teacher.
  • Attend parent-teacher conferences: Use these opportunities to discuss your child’s progress and any concerns or suggestions.
  • Volunteer or participate: Show your support by volunteering in the classroom or participating in school events.
  • Respect the teacher’s expertise: Trust the teacher’s professional judgment and follow their guidance regarding your child’s development.

Preschool preparation is crucial for all children, but it may require special considerations for those with developmental delays or learning disabilities. Understanding their unique needs and providing appropriate support can help ensure their success in a preschool environment.

Children with developmental delays or learning disabilities may face challenges in areas such as language, communication, motor skills, or social interaction. It’s essential to identify these areas early on and provide targeted interventions to support their development.

Resources for Parents and Caregivers

  • Early Intervention Programs: These programs offer specialized services and support for young children with developmental delays or disabilities.
  • Special Education Services: Schools provide special education services to eligible children with disabilities, including preschoolers.
  • Support Groups: Connecting with other parents and caregivers of children with special needs can provide emotional support and valuable information.

Ensuring an Inclusive and Supportive Preschool Environment

Creating an inclusive and supportive preschool environment is vital for all children, especially those with special needs. Here are some strategies:

  • Individualized Support: Provide individualized support based on each child’s strengths and needs, such as modified activities or accommodations.
  • Positive Reinforcement: Encourage positive behavior and focus on celebrating children’s successes, no matter how small.
  • Collaboration: Work closely with parents, caregivers, and therapists to ensure continuity of care and support.
  • Educating Staff: Provide staff with training and resources to help them understand and support children with special needs.
